Real Madrid make a staggering bid of €120m and Luka Jovic plus Keylor Navas for Neymar

https://www.caughtoffside.com/2019/08/23/real-madrid-make-staggering-bid-of-e120m-and-one-of-their-summer-signings-for-neymar/

Part of the fun surrounding the whole Neymar saga this Summer is trying to decipher what’s true and what seems to be absolute nonsense. This story is one of those that you could argue could make sense but it remains to be seen if the move actually goes through.

According to Serbian outlet Zurnal, Real Madrid are close to agreeing a deal to bring Neymar back to Spain from PSG. They report the deal would cost Real €120m plus Keylor Navas and new signing Luka Jovic.

Bundesliga transfers: Bas Dost joins Eintracht Frankfurt

Bas Dost's protracted move to Eintracht Frankfurt has finally been confirmed. The Dutch target man returns for a second stint in the Bundesliga after a prolific spell in Portugal.
